Three minors were injured after being struck by vehicles in separate incidents while crossing Middle Road in As Mahetog and Garapan on Wednesday.

Police officer Jason Tarkong confirmed that three children were injured in the two accidents, including a student who had just gotten down from a school bus near the road going to the Saipan Zoo.

Tarkong said he will be preparing a press release about the incidents.

Saipan Tribune learned that, in the As Mahetog accident, the legs of an 11-year-old boy were fractured. He was taken to the Commonwealth Health Center.

The boy was among the passengers of a Public School System bus that had just come from Tanapag. As the bus stopped across a bus stop on a road leading to the Saipan Zoo, students began crossing Middle Road. A car struck the boy, a fifth grade student.

It was not clear whether the vehicle was going toward Tanapag or to the Puerto Rico area.

The bus stop is located along a curve in the road.

In the second accident, two children sustained minor injuries when a vehicle hit them as they were crossing Middle Road near the museum in Garapan. No other details were available as of press time yesterday.
